Bill leads the energy regulatory team in the firm’s Washington, D.C., office. He has more than three decades of practice experience successfully representing energy clients before all three branches of government.
Bill has lectured on legislative process at Yale University School of Management, George Washington University School of Law and the Department of Defense National War College. He also has written and lectured extensively on natural gas policy and legal issues.
Bill was the principal legislative draftsman of both the Natural Gas Policy Act of 1978 and the Petroleum Marketing Practices Act. He served as congressional committee counsel from 1973 to 1979.
Bill’s energy clients are engaged in upstream production and midstream operations and include independent natural gas producers, integrated oil companies, and gatherers, processors and marketers of oil and natural gas. He has represented clients in a wide range of energy transactions and acquisitions, natural gas regulatory proceedings, commercial litigation and arbitration disputes, and government enforcement proceedings.
